Etymology

[edit]

Inherited from Sauraseni Prakrit 𑀲𑀉𑀢𑁆𑀢𑀻 (saüttī), from Sanskrit सपत्नी (sapátnī), from Proto-Indo-Iranian *sapátniH, from Proto-Indo-European *sm̥-pót-nih₂, from *sm̥- (together, co-) + *pótnih₂ (wife). Doublet of सपत्नी (sapatnī).

Noun

[edit]

सौत (sautf (Urdu spelling سوت)

  1. a co-wife
